From 1cefe26a998540d5aea4dbfc64e51765d5604c8b Mon Sep 17 00:00:00 2001 From: Alexander Barton Date: Thu, 17 Dec 2015 17:16:29 +0100 Subject: [PATCH] New "xinetd" role --- roles/xinetd/handlers/main.yml | 7 +++++++ roles/xinetd/meta/main.yml | 5 +++++ roles/xinetd/tasks/main.yml | 11 +++++++++++ 3 files changed, 23 insertions(+) create mode 100644 roles/xinetd/handlers/main.yml create mode 100644 roles/xinetd/meta/main.yml create mode 100644 roles/xinetd/tasks/main.yml diff --git a/roles/xinetd/handlers/main.yml b/roles/xinetd/handlers/main.yml new file mode 100644 index 0000000..2b7fdb3 --- /dev/null +++ b/roles/xinetd/handlers/main.yml @@ -0,0 +1,7 @@ +--- +# handlers file for xinetd + +- name: restart "xinetd" + service: > + name=xinetd + state=restarted diff --git a/roles/xinetd/meta/main.yml b/roles/xinetd/meta/main.yml new file mode 100644 index 0000000..665ee38 --- /dev/null +++ b/roles/xinetd/meta/main.yml @@ -0,0 +1,5 @@ +--- +# meta file for xinetd + +dependencies: + - { role: os-base } diff --git a/roles/xinetd/tasks/main.yml b/roles/xinetd/tasks/main.yml new file mode 100644 index 0000000..299c4c6 --- /dev/null +++ b/roles/xinetd/tasks/main.yml @@ -0,0 +1,11 @@ +--- +# tasks file for xinetd + +- name: install xinetd(8) + tags: + - packages + apt: > + state=installed + name={{ item }} + with_items: + - xinetd -- 2.39.2